A St. Thomas man surrendered to police without incident after striking his father “several times” with the sharp side of a machete, authorities said.
Naj’Jah Crabbe, 34, was arrested Tuesday and charged with third-degree assault-domestic violence, the Virgin Islands Police Department said.
“Crabbe threw stones at his father and later struck him several times with a bladed side of a machete causing injuries about the body,” VIPD Communications Director Glen Dratte said.
Crabbe was later turned in by a family member at the Special Operation Bureau where he was transported to the Schneider Regional Medical Center and placed under arrest, according to Dratte.
